Transaction 893259ed60b16f69ca06ec6ee64ff1e4823855956e51ff6b42d29aaaab385043
1 Input
1 Output
-
893259ed60b16f69ca06ec6ee64ff1e4823855956e51ff6b42d29aaaab385043:0
- value
- 821287655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92b23f3ea2cbf4d324bdcc8c33d7d97c0b20bfbc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ENfBq6yGeEMFqxGaJqa75VGr3hh3fx2WX